Definition of a complex number.

Complex numbersare expressed in the form of z=x+iy, where x,y are real numbers, and i is an imaginary number.

Similarly, the function of z is represented as follows:

f(z)=f(x+iy)=u(x,y)+iv(x,y), where u(x,y)is the real part andv(x,y) is the imaginary part.

Polar form of complex number is represented as:

x+iy=reiθ,wherer=x2+y2,θ=tan-1(yx)
